The application can be completely new, so the only way of reestablishing a message handler automatically would be by reflection, as far as I can see. And that would be unreliable.
It's the same situation as the default message handler - you have to set the callback again when the client object is recreated.
In this case, the call to set the message handler is subscribe(), so if we call subscribe() again we could optimize by not issuing the MQTT subscribe packet (as long as cleansession is false on both sessions).

The Python client does this and checks every callback filter to see if it matches, and hence will deliver a single message to multiple callbacks if they overlap. It will deliver the message to the "global" callback if it does not match any of the filtered callbacks.

I'm proposing to add per subscription message handling callbacks to the
Java client.
https://bugs.eclipse.org/bugs/show_bug.cgi?id=466579
This will mean having to parse and match the incoming topics, as MQTT
does not send the subscription topic with each message, but the topic on
which the original message was published. I have some simple code that
does that in the embedded C++ client however.
